- Summary:
- Simple displacement and pressure controls were satisfactory for hydrostatic transmissions in the past. Present demands for more work with smaller prime movers have spawned new controls wich improve efficiency and simplify the operator's job to attain it. Future applications have requirements that are as yet undefined, but will demand transmissions with control concepts that can respond to these requirements. Control element modules which may be built up to suit specific needs are one possible way to attain this capability
